Transaction 6531c83afe61dc41c17bdcecb519e97fdf296c51e2d5b624577eceec0f336062
1 Input
1 Output
-
6531c83afe61dc41c17bdcecb519e97fdf296c51e2d5b624577eceec0f336062:0
- value
- 2058632
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d374c7fb0b2f0cab3c0fcb765dd2980833586ba4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LH5UaKVkdoBASbcnmjoEPT3FEsLwV7YEs